Rules:
  • Irregular Sudoku: Place the digits 1-9 once each in every row, column, and outlined region.
  • XV: An X between two cells indicates that the digits in those cells sum to 10. A V between two cells indicates that the digits in those cells sum to 5. Cells without an X or V between them must not sum to 5 or 10.
  • Japanese Sums: The colored circles outside the grid indicate the order of runs of contiguous cells found in that row or column that must be shaded the color of the clue. The number in the clue indicates the sum of the cells in the run. There must be at least one unshaded cell between runs of the same color, though there is no need between runs of differing colors. A '?' as a clue represents any unknown total. All runs are given.
